It's an excellent mixture of sweetness and tangyness but feels so refreshing and tastes very strongly like an orangey/lemoney/limey flavour. Citrus, you might say. It's a still drink so doesn't make you feel bloated and it actually gave me a new burst of energy after i drank it all.
The bottles come in 500ml sizes and for you health concious people, it contains 0.0g of salt, saturates and fat, 45kcal calories and 10.3g of sugar, which i think comes through on the taste, but it's not such a bad thing.
I must say after a while, my mouth is usually left quite dry and i feel like i need some water or some rehydrating. But this is a small niggle when drinking a drink with a taste like this. I've also gone on to find some shops who sell the drink for around 80-90p.
